links• Differentiate links
–DON’T CHANGE DEFAULT color• Don’t use generic instructions• Don’t use generic links• Make sure the link explicitly
indicates what will happen.
Navigation should always lead back home
• Use common scheme for page navigation. –ALWAYS link back to the home
page or other pages on the web site. –Orphan page: A page with no link to the
home page
unity• Common look and feel for
each page on the site–Sense of uniformity–Common graphic elements and
colors on each page
fonts• On paper
–serif fonts – fonts with a “tail”–Times New Roman
• On screens–sans-serif fonts–Verdana or Arial
• Don’t use more than 3 different fonts

oh sure, it LOOKS good but ...
• Reading from a computer screen = 25% slower
• Write 50% less text than on paper
